Association of serum uric acid and serum uric acid/creatinine ratio with metabolic dysfunction-associated fatty liver disease in young adults: a retrospective study
Abstract Background Metabolic dysfunction-associatedsteatotic liver disease (MASLD) has become the most prevalent chronic liver disease worldwide. Its incidence continues to rise with a marked trend toward younger age groups, posing dual challenges for early screening and standardized diagnosis and...
